#bb73f3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bb73f3 is composed of 73.3% red, 45.1% green and 95.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23% cyan, 52.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 273.8 degrees, a saturation of 84.2% and a lightness of 70.2%. #bb73f3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e6ff with #7700e7.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

#bb73f3 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#bb73f3 has RGB values of R:187, G:115, B:243 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0.53,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 12284915.

Shades and Tints of #bb73f3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030005 is the darkest color, while #f8f1fe is the lightest one.
